Output ccedaf076c143c1c5318832f312f9feb61a996a7dda3e7c90bdce01b051ca21b:2

value
7630036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ae52932c40ed8a9e442562c1bce0663893aa3f OP_EQUAL
address
3DhHGpMPL7D68RPwh85FTKRyMuQzVoHCuC
transaction
ccedaf076c143c1c5318832f312f9feb61a996a7dda3e7c90bdce01b051ca21b
spent
true